Over the weekend, The New York Times published a highly critical inside look at Amazon's office environment.

The piece describes an intense, "bruising" work environment for Amazon's white-collar employees.

But Amazon also employs tens of thousands of workers in its more than 90 fulfillment and sortation centers located all around the world.

These workers, whose job it is to make sure Amazon ships products to customers in a timely manner, have their own set of challenges.
